Boik, John. CANCER AND NATURAL MEDICINE: A TEXTBOOK OF BASIC SCIENCE AND CLINICAL
RESEARCH Oregon Medical Press: 1996.  ISBN 0-9648280-0-6
“John Boik’s work is important because he gives the backbone to many of the alt med remedies.” – Lyn S.

Boik, John NATURAL COMPOUNDS IN CANCER THERAPY ISBN 0-9648280-1-4) 2001

“This book as well as Boik’s first book,”Cancer in Natural Medicine” 1996 is for the research oriented.  They
are not books that one can sit down and read from cover to cover.  They show tons of research, some of
which can be transposed to treatment modalities.  The beauty of these books, however, is they are
comprehensive in explaining important factors when researching cancer.  They explain well Initiation,
proliferation and cell death of cancer; Angiogenesis; Invasion;  Metastasis; Ph and neoplasia; The
immune system;  Treatments of cancer; Theory of Chinese Medicine;  Antitumor effects of botanical
agents; Dietary macronutrients on cancer; and overviews of many types of cancer.

D’Adamo Peter J, M.D, LIVE RIGHT FOR YOUR TYPE ISBN 9780399-14673-3)2001

"This book is a follow up to the original book Eat Right for Your Type.  LRFYT is a much more
comprehensive book which outlines eating and living according to one’s most basic genetic profile, one’s
blood type.  Dr. D’Adamo shows how this concept affects immunity, disease propensity, and surviving even
cancer by altering one’s concept of food and supplements, and exercise plans.  It includes much more than
the first book in that it also addresses secretor status as a biomarker for dietary changes.

LRFYT includes a comprehensive appendices which includes all the research on the blood type diet and
lifestyle.  This was missing from the original book due to the publisher’s decision on making the first book
into more of a “diet book.”  One of Dr. D’Adamo’s latest books: CANCER: FIGHT IT WITH THE BLOOD TYPE
DIET (2004) is a good companion for LRFYT, because the lists are specific for battling cancer.
